I dunno, maybe he's sick of the snow. Anyhow, RPO president and CEO Richard Nowlin has resigned and taken a post as executive director of the Wells Fargo Center For The Arts in Santa Rosa, California. Nowlin has been with the RPO since 1996.
Under Nowlin the RPO boasted a surplus of $18,000 this past year with increased ticket sales, concert attendance, contributed revenue, and endowment earnings.
